   My essay on the Salem Witch Trials

                                 By: Prithvi Joshi

 

 

 

 A lot has been learned about the Salem Witch Trials. A lot has been learned about how they happened, a lot has been learned about the court, and a lot has been learned about the victims. The Salem Witch trials were a dark time in history. The reasons behind them are puzzling, but the tragedies that occurred in that courtroom have been with us since the incident.

 

The Salem Witch Trials all started with over-religious colonists. There was an outbreak of smallpox, as well as tension between many people. In general, times were tough. And who do overly-religious colonists, going through bad times, most likely to blame for their problems? That’s right, Satan. But they haven’t seen Satan…. perhaps he has created witches! The colonists thought about this, but there was no evidence of witches in Salem, so they gave up this theory. A slave named Tibuita, was telling children stories about witches. She was discovered and convicted of witchcraft. But, soon after, the children that Tibuita told stories to, became sick. The children would have violent fits, moments where they were completely zoned out, moments where they would cower in fear, and moments when they were completely normal. Doctors were baffled, they had no idea what caused the behavior, but when one doctor diagnosed the children with “affliction by witchcraft” the community was consume by terror. And thus, the biggest and bloodiest witch hunt in America’s history, began.

 

 

 

The court of Oyer and Terminer was the court that everybody went to if they found a witch. The techniques that they used were primarily spiritual, so many of the convicted people had no chance of defending themselves. The court also used the afflicted people to testify against the convicted witches. One way they would use the afflicted people was to force the convicted people to touch an afflicted person during a fit, if the fit magically stopped, the convicted person was a witch who stopped the fit. If a person was guilty of witchcraft, they had two choices, they could say nothing and be hanged, or they could give up the name of another witch and be put in prison for a few years. When somebody was about to be hanged, they had a chance to recite a sermon from the bible. If they recite it correctly, they were proved innocent. The court used this method for a very long time, but when hundreds of people were being put in prison, they started becoming skeptical that so many people were actually guilty of this crime. Eventually the courts were shut down, but not without ruining the lives of hundreds of people.

 

 

 

During the trials, 20 people were killed and hundreds of people were imprisoned. The first person convicted of witchcraft was Tibuita, she was given the choice of naming other witches or being hanged. She named two people: Sarah Good and Sarah Osborne. When they were arrested they named witches, and when THOSE people were arrested, they also named witches, and so on until one person named Bridget Bishop was arrested. Bridget did not name a witch because she did not want a person to be arrested. On that same week, Bridget was hanged in public. The promptness of her execution left people worried about themselves, and the first doubts about the trials had started. Many more people were hanged in public. One of those people was a reverend named George Burroughs. George was famous for accidently, mortally wounding somebody in a bar fight. He was convicted for many reasons including “inhuman strength granted by the devil.” He was taken to the execution field and given a chance to recite the sermon from the bible. He recited it so perfectly that the spectators had tears in their eyes. George was executed anyways because “the devil granted him the power to say the sermon.” After his execution, more people started to doubt the fact that these people were witches. Some people even started to send messages saying the trials were inhuman and unfair to the accused. One of those people was a man named John Proctor.

 

John was a very famous and highly respected man. But one of the afflicted children accused his wife of witchcraft. John went to court, saying that it was ridiculous that his wife was a witch. The court said that she was a witch, but she would be spared because she was pregnant. John on the other hand…. He was trying to protect a witch, this means he must be a witch!!! John was sent to prison for a short while, but he did not know any other witches. John was executed that same week. This left the community in an outrage. Many people were against the witch trials after this. But the last straw was the killing of Giles Corey.

 

Giles was hated by most people. He was put in prison a few years before for killing his farmhand. But his death was a very important step in ending the trials. Giles was accused of witchcraft by an afflicted child, but he refused to testify. No matter what they said, he refused to testify. If he testified he would lose his property and his children would never own the house. Instead he was sentenced to a "peine forte et dure.” A "peine forte et dure" was a kind of torture where the prisoner was stripped naked and forced to lie down on his back, a board was put on his belly, and then over the course of many days, heavy stones would be put on the boards until the prisoner dies or agrees to testify. Giles refused to testify, instead, he endured the torture for 3 days before dying. He kept saying things like “more stones” and “kill me faster.” His horrific death played a big part in the ending of the trials.
